A producer has a history of making bad movies. The movies he has produced have averaged $160,000 dollars at the box office with a standard deviation of $185,000. He thinks his latest movie will be a huge hit. How much will the movie earn at the box office if it is only expected to earn that much or more 0.5% of the time? (Assume that the profit at the box office is normally distributed.)
